How to fix Nintendo Switch Joy-Con drift with Mario Kart 8
Here is a Magical Guide to fix Joy-Con drift for Mario Kart 8 on Nintendo Switch:
1. Recalibrate the Joy-Con
Go to The System Settings > Controllers and or Sensors > Calibrate Control Sticks.
Follow on-screen all instructions to reset the sticks neutral position.
Test in Mario Kart 8 (e.g. drive straight without drifting).
2. Clean the Joy-Con
Turn off the Joy-Con.
Dip a cottons swab in isopropy alcohols (70%+).
Gently Rub around the base of the stick (rotate it to clean debris).
Let dry for 5 minutes before reconnectings.
3. Replace the Joystick (Last Resort)
Buy a Joy-Con joystick replacement kit (
10-10–15 on a Amazon).
Follow YouTube tutorial (e.g. Joy-Con Stick Replacement Guide).
Test in Mario Kart 8 after Reassembly.
4. Temporary Fixes for Mario Kart 8
Use a Pro Controller: Pair it wirelessly to bypass Joy-Con drift.
Adjust In The Game Settings:
Turn on Auto Accelerate (reduces Stick usage).
Use Motion Control (tilt to steer instead of the stick).
5. Contact Nintendo (Free to Repair)
If under warranty (And or even expired in some regions):
Visit Nintendo Support.
Submit repair request (U.S./EU repairs are often free for drift).
Why This Magical Method Works
Recalibration/cleaning fixes minor debris And calibration errors.
Replacement/repair addresses worn-out internal sensors.
Important Note: Avoid compressed air (can push debris deeper).

What Causes Joy-Con Drift
Before trying to fixes your Nintendo Switch its might be a little helpful to understand what its thats caused this issue in the first place. When its comes to Joy-Con Drift. the usual culprit is the dust or dirt debris that comes with months of usages interfering with the analog sticks internals components. When used over long periods of times these are things can build up under the joystick covering and end up causings resistance. This in turn, lead to the Nintendo Switch sensors detecting the resistance as unintended movements and causing drift.
But it is not just thats general wear and tear on the analog sticks mechanism can also lead to drift. And especially if the contacts on your Switch are not perfectly aligned and connecting Very smoothly. The Manufacturing flaws that allows dust ingress and lead to early wear are other potential factor. While it may seem frustratings the causes of drift ultimately come down to routine usages taking toll over hundreds And thousands of gameplay hours.
